The factors that characterize posture are neurophysiological, biomechanical, psychoemotional. Neurophysiological factors concern the modulation of tone, muscle tone is the result of a series of neuropsychological processes within the tonic-postural system. The tonic-postural system can become unbalanced for various reasons, including a tight lingual frenum. The aim of this pilot study was to evaluate the benefits of frenulectomy by laser on body posture and on the scapular (shoulders) anteroposterior movement. Twenty-four healthy subjects were selected, between the ages of 10 and 26 years (mean age 15.22) who presented a short lingual frenum and a low posture of the tongue and jaw. https://www.selleckchem.com/JNK.html They were examined using the Marchesan Protocol for Lingual Frenum and the Spinometry® Formetric and underwent laser frenectomy by diode laser (Siro Laser Blu. 660 nm) without any post-surgery complications. The release of the frenulum immediately brought benefits to patients, reorganizing the physiological modulation, and the movement of the tongue within the normal parameters of temporomandibular kinematics which were within physiological parameters. We want to underline the key role of the dentist as a promoter of prevention of oral disorders as well as being able to deal with the possible complications which may occur.It is widely recognized that the physiology of childbirth labor largely depends on the interaction between three factors a) the force generated by uterine contractions; b) the structure and characteristics of the birth canal and c) the fetus. Harmony between these three variables determines the initiation of maternal dynamic phenomena and the establishment of an optimal maternal-fetal balance in which both warrant for a correct delivery timing. The present study considered the above known factors and assessed if any other factor, still not recognized, could also play a role, and eventually modify the timing of delivery during the expulsive period. In particular, we focused our attention on the role played by the temporomandibular joint and dental occlusion on maternal body balance and on the stability of muscular reflected forces. The importance of assessing the temporomandibular function and the dental occlusion lies in the fact that any alteration in chewing or in temporomandibular joint (TMJ) mobility and occlusion brings to relevant modifications on the vertebral column and pelvic girdle. Our hypothesis is based on the evidence that those women who have any kind of alteration in their dental occlusion, can have an altered capability of pushing during the expulsive period, as the force applied on the pelvic floor is not expressed. Moreover, recent studies have highlighted a relationship between temporomandibular dysfunctions and sleep apnea syndrome and between sleep apnea syndromes and pregnancy. Bioceramic cements used in root filling show interesting properties including extraordinary sealing capacities, antimicrobial activity that stimulates periapical healing and the continuous production of hydroxyopathitis for a long time. This case report deals with the application of bioceramic cement in endodontic retreatment. The Bioroot RCS (Septodont), thanks to its ability to firmly adhere both to the gutta-percha and to the walls of the canal and to definitively seal the apical third, can allow to obtain extraordinary healing in a relatively short time by exploiting its antimicrobial abilities. Knowledge of sinus anatomy and evaluation of risk factors are the basis of regenerative and rehabilitative surgical success. The positioning and size of the lateral antrostomy represent critical factors in the execution of regenerative surgery, due to the difficulty in transferring radiological information to the lateral wall of the maxillary sinus even for skilled surgeons. The knowhow of guided implant surgery in recent years is also finding use in planning and precisely delineating the lateral access to the maxillary sinus using CBCT imaging and dimensional reconstruction software, through the realization of surgical guides with 3D printing, as shown in the presented case.
